Rangers ace Nicolas Raskin 'wanted' by La Liga giants

Rangers star Nicolas Raskin is reportedly wanted by Spanish giants Real Betis, as they aim to replace two key midfielders.

Russell Martin faces a fight to keep hold of the Ibrox club's star player this summer, with interest growing in the Belgium international. 

The 24-year-old has two years remaining on his contract, having arrived in 2023 from Standard Liege for around £1.75m.

His transfer valuation has increased exponentially since then, with the Scottish Premiership giants in line to pocket a huge profit in any future sale.

While Martin would love to keep Raskin, there is a possibility that he is sold this summer. 

And Spanish media outlet Mucho Deporte claims that Betis could be the club to test the water. 

They say that Rasin has impressed manager Manuel Pellegrini as he looks at potential replacements for outgoing midfielders Johnny Cardoso and William Carvalho.

Both players played key roles in helping the Seville side to the final of last season's Europa Conference League, where they were defeated by Chelsea.

Carvalho - who hasn't actually left the club yet unlike Cardoso - also won the 2016 Euros with Portugal, and the 2018/19 Nations League.
